A Preliminary Study to Evaluate PF-07264660 in Healthy Participants

Official title
A PHASE 1, RANDOMIZED, DOUBLE-BLIND, SPONSOR-OPEN, PLACEBO-CONTROLLED, DOSE-ESCALATING STUDY TO EVALUATE THE SAFETY, TOLERABILITY, PHARMACOKINETICS, AND PHARMACODYNAMICS OF SINGLE AND MULTIPLE INTRAVENOUS AND SUBCUTANEOUS DOSES OF PF-07264660 IN HEALTHY PARTICIPANTS

The purpose of this clinical trial is to learn about the safety and effects of study medicine PF-07264660 compared to a placebo. This is the first study of PF-07264660 in humans. All participants in this study will received PF-07264660 or a placebo and it will be assigned by chance. People may be able to participate if they are healthy. The study medicine may be given by shots under the skin or through a vein depending on which group you are assigned to. If you are assigned into Part A, you will receive the study medicine once, stay overnight at the research unit from 3 to 5 overnight stays and you will need to visit the clinic about 11 follow-up visits. Participants will be in this study for up to about 541 days. If you are assigned into Part B, you will receive the study medicine three times, stay overnight at the clinic from 3 to 5 overnight stays and you will need to visit the research unit about 12 follow-up visits. Participants willbe in this study for up to about 561 days.
